CBD - is it worth it?

I've been using CBD ointments, salves, and creams for almost 3 years now with varying effectiveness. So I went hunting. I want to provide the best products for my clients without breaking the bank. I ordered 2 different products (plus the one I have been using) and I am trying them out, one by one. Giving each one and entire day to see if it works, how long it lasts, how it smells etc.

Today I tried CBD Healthcare company's CBD Natural Relief Salve 1000mg Maximum Strength. Now, this is a bit on the pricey side. Retail it is $114 for 1 fl oz.


I put this amount :


On the top and sides of my right ankle at 11:30 am. I get injections in that ankle every 3 months and when the shot wears off, as it has now and I still have weeks to go before my next one, it is PAINFUL. It smells AWESOME. Like coconut, lavender and eucalyptus and not a lot of the eucalyptus. It feel warm and comforting going on. Within 15 minutes it was less painful. By 1pm I was OUT OF PAIN. Now i don't mean i could play basketball or dance. Certainly not (maybe?). But I was able to work and not wince on the inside with every step I took or to sit and have it throb even though I was snot moving it. it was better. Much, much better. It slowly wore off so as i sit here at 8:45pm it does not hurt if I am resting and if i stand, it hurts but not enough to limp. I am impressed. If I had reapplied it, I could maybe do some light belly dance. Totally worth the price tag. Tomorrow we will try the other new one.
